Danalynnkaye is a U.S.-based fitness entrepreneur and content creator whose identity is closely tied to Devotion Nutrition, the protein powder brand she owns and operates. Her content blends founder-led brand promotion with genuine lifestyle storytelling — recipe demos, packing and travel-wellness tips, and glimpses of her life as a mother of three. The tone sits somewhere between polished entrepreneur and relatable everywoman: she'll post a QVC segment one day and a self-deprecating caption about "country a$$ shizzzz" the next. She also hosts a podcast, "Until It's Done," which extends her entrepreneurship-and-mindset messaging beyond short-form content and signals a longer-form audience relationship.
With a micro-tier following on Instagram, Danalynnkaye's standout metric is engagement — running at roughly three times the category median — which points to an audience that is genuinely invested rather than passively scrolling. Her core viewers skew toward millennial women in the 25–34 bracket, a demographic with high purchase intent in the wellness and supplement space. The QVC appearances are particularly telling: they position Devotion Nutrition as a retail-crossover brand, not just a social-native one, and reinforce her credibility as a founder with real commercial traction. Devotion Nutrition is a protein powder brand founded and owned by Danalynnkaye herself. She built and runs the company, positioning it as a premium, flavor-forward fitness supplement. It is one of the central pillars of her personal brand and content.
Yes, Devotion Nutrition has been featured on QVC for live shopping segments, with Danalynnkaye appearing on-air to present the product directly to viewers. She has promoted specific QVC air dates to her audience so fans can tune in and shop in real time.
Until It's Done… a devoted podcast is Danalynnkaye's show, which reflects her entrepreneur and perseverance-driven mindset. The podcast sits alongside her fitness and business content as an extension of her brand philosophy around commitment and follow-through.
